Form | Lyophilized To keep the original salt concentration, we recommend reconstituting to the original concentration prior to lyophilization (see Concentration) in ddH2O. If a lower concentration is required, dilute in PBS, pH 7.4. If a higher concentration is required, the product can be reconstituted directly in PBS, pH 7.4, though please note that this will change the overall salt concentration. The stock concentration should be between 0.1-1.0 mg/ml. Do not vortex. |

Descripción
AATF (Apoptosis Antagonizing Transcription Factor), also known as Che-1, is a transcription factor involved in various cellular processes, including the regulation of apoptosis, cell cycle progression, and DNA damage response. It acts as a survival factor by inhibiting apoptotic pathways and promoting cell proliferation and survival.It also interacts directly with nuclear hormone receptors to enhance their transactivation. This gene product contains a leucine zipper, which is a characteristic motif of transcription factors, and was shown to exhibit strong transactivation activity when fused to Gal4 DNA binding domain. Overexpression of this gene interfered with MAP3K12 induced apoptosis
